Casa North Coast Villa - Portrush
55.19008, -6.65821Boasting a location approximately 20 minutes on foot from Barry's Amusements, the 1-bedroom Casa North Coast Villa provides a patio with garden views. Featuring a hot tub, the property is nestled about a 25-minute stroll from Coastal Zone at Portrush Waterside Museum.
Location
Historical attractions in the vicinity include Dunluce Castle, located 6 km away. This villa offers sports enthusiasts to discover Royal Portrush Golf Club, located 2.6 km away.
Travellers can easily reach City of Derry airport, which is 50 km from Casa North Coast Villa.
Rooms
Guests can enjoy access to a patio and a dressing room, as well as an iron with ironing board for a more comfortable stay. Additionally, media facilities, such as a flat-screen TV with satellite channels, ensure a more enjoyable stay. Featuring a separate toilet and a shower, the bathroom also comes with dryers and dressing gowns.
Eat & Drink
Along with coffee and tea making facilities, a fully equipped kitchen is provided in the property for cooking purposes. There is also a microwave oven, a coffeemaker, and a fridge available in the kitchen. Leona's Tea Room & Bakery, serving British dishes, is a stroll from the villa.
